The Great Game Of Business
Another site based on a specific look created by this company's marketing guru, Steve Baker, only this time much larger in scale. A tremendous amount of information had to be included on the website, and be presented one screen at a time, including audio and video features, a shopping cart, several different registration forms and a members-only reference section. (In-house management changes have taken this website in several different directions since our original design.)

Family Back & Neck Care Centre
Another large site with large amounts of information to display to potiential patients. Mainly text in this case, so we broke up the long expository segments into smaller paragraphs, and alternated the text with images back and forth across every page for a uniform and readable presentation. Color-coordinated pictures were used wherever possible to maintain the look; healthy, happy people give indication of the successful results that patients will receive at FBNCC.

AcuPoint Health Clinic
The owners of AcuPoint Health Clinic wanted a website that demonstrated the Eastern origins and disciplines of acupuncture, without overwhelming potential clients with Oriental symbology. We used relaxing nature-scapes, as well as pictures with lots of light and clean lines, to show the calming effect of acupuncture treatments, and limited the Oriental touches to yin-yang symbols and a little bamboo. (This site has also recently been redesigned, by another company -- and they did a good job.)

Springfield Mechanical Services
Redesign of an existing site based on a series of single-page informational sheets designed by the company's general manager. The original site was a gray, blah mess, so the challenge was to bring the site to life with color and purpose, using bullet points and stock photography provided by SMSI, and make it interesting! Lots of little touches went into this one, like using hard hats for custom bullets, and putting at least one picture of a hard-working employee on almost every page. (The company has since redesigned their site in-house; feel free to compare!)
